    I'm writing this review to warn everyone about the thief (Brad Gill) that stole my blueprints/physical design plans that I paid $1400 for through another company. This review is long overdue! Brad came to my house on 12/7/18 to provide an estimate to remodel my backyard. I informed Brad that I recently hired a landscape designer to measure and recommend the most optimal layout, material and design of my backyard yard based on all of my wishlist items (again, I paid $1400 for the designs plans). The design was extensive, including precise measurements, exact materials, pictures of the various features, color palette and plans to completely gut my backyard, construct a built-in-BBQ, firepit, waterwall, pergola, new block wall, gates, travertine pavers, "zen area" with hammock, lighting, electrical work (including outdoor speakers and TV) and new landscape. I showed Brad the plans, after we discussed everything for about 30 minutes, he asked if he could borrow them so he could provide a more accurate estimate based on the measurements and material that I selected in my design. At first, I was very hesitant to give him my plans, especially since I paid so much money for them. However, he reassured me and said that he would would give them back to me as soon as he finished the estimates and afterall, what did he have to gain by keeping them? He came highly recommended on Nextdoor (and the Yelp reviews were also great). He then reassured me again and said that it was very hard to quote me an exact estimate without having the plans next to him while he put everything together. He also made a comment and said, "If I don't bring them back, you can leave me a horrible review and I don't want that because it could interfere with potential business." He came across very trustworthy and charismatic and since I had two copies of the plans (with my address and name on them) it made me feel a little more comfortable so I agreed to let him borrow one of my copies. Keep in mind, these plans are 34" x 24" so it's not like I could just scan them from my computer and email it to him. After we discussed timeline, Brad said that he would send me the estimates the following week and that point, he would return the design plans and we can discuss next steps. I agreed and waited his response. Looking back at the situation, I should have listened to my gut because he never returned my design plans. On 12/12/18, I received an email from Scott Gill with the estimates. However, the estimates only included the block wall. I replied back on the same day, asking about the rest of the items that were included in the design plans (see attached screenshot of our email). Unfortunately I did not receive a response back. I thought my email might have got stuck in SPAM so after 2 days (12/14/18), I called back (562) 276-8910 but I received a voicemail so I left a message. This was on a Friday, so I waited again until the following Tuesday (12/18/18) and when I did not hear back from them again, I called back and left another message. I called again on 12/21/18 and left a message for a 3rd and final time indicating that if I don't hear back from them, I will assume that they kept my plans and have no intentions of returning them. I waited again until after the holidays and at this point I realized that I was never getting my design plans back. I figured they stole the plans and tried to pass them off as their own work to impress potential customers. As you can see from this review, I'm extremely detailed and I documented every step of this process and was fully planning on making a review a long time ago but I put it on the back-burner because it was not a high priority at the time. I continued my search with other contractors, ultimately decided to move forward with another company and finished all of the work on my backyard. Fast forward nearly 2 years later, I moved to a new house and was looking for additional work and Gill Hardscape popped up again. I document all of my interactions with my contractors via OneNote and when I saw their name, it brought back all kinds of bad memories and got my blood boiling. I stopped my search, reviewed my previous notes on Gill Hardscape from December of 2018 and I had to write this review to warn other people about their dishonesty. I'm completely surprised that they have such good reviews, but I had to share my experience to potential/future customers. I hope this review helps other people and I wish I would have wrote this sooner.

    Brad & his crew did a great job. Working with the landscape architect, Brad offered suggestions that saved about 15% on the original estimate. Brad spent a lot of extra time looking for the right flagstone without changing his estimate. His crew was friendly, neat, professional and cleaned up at the end of each day. Very satisfied! Ps: We asked for an existing stone heart to be placed among the flagstone. On their own, his crew cut out a few more hearts & placed them among the project. It looked like they got as much enjoyment out of doing that as we got seeing their work.
